N2 - In our previous works, we developed a system named SCROLL in order to log, organize, recall and evaluate the learning log. However up to now, we just use an active mode to record logs. This means that a learner must take a capture of learned contents consciously and most of learning chances be lost unconsciously. This paper proposes a system named PACALL (Passive Capture for Learning Log) in order to have a passive capture using Sense Cam to solve this problem. With the help of Sense Cam, learner's activity can be captured as a series of images. With the help of this system, a learner can find the important images by analyzing sensor data and images processing technology. Finally, the selected images will be uploaded to the current SCROLL system as ubiquitous learning logs. This research suggests that Sense Cam can be used to do passive capture of learning experiences and workload of reflection can be reduced by analyzing sensor data of Sense Cam.
